As Marvel Rivals prepares for its highly anticipated Season 2.5 update, users are filled with excitement and anticipation regarding the game’s competitive scene. The mid-season patch promises a plethora of new content, including the addition of Ultron as a playable character, a new Arakko map, and improved team-up skills, all geared at shaking up the meta.

With a large balance patch and new incentive systems like the Combat Chest, the update is set to reenergize the community. However, one major concern remains: will Season 2.5 feature a rank reset for competitive players?

Rank resets have been a contentious topic since Season 1, when NetEase received criticism for a proposed mid-season rank modification. The devs eventually scrapped a half-season reset due to community uproar, instead requiring players to complete 10 matches above Gold rank to gain exclusive items such as skins and Crests of Honor. This precedent has spurred speculation about Season 2.5’s rank reset and whether there is one or not.

Does Marvel Rivals Season 2.5 has a rank reset?

Marvel Rivals Season 2.5, being a mid-season update, does not include a rank reset based on previous seasons’ information.

Season 2 began with a full rank reset, reducing players to nine categories (e.g., from Diamond I to Silver I) to renew the competitive ladder and provide a level playing field. However, neither official sources nor leaks indicate that Season 2.5, as a mid-season patch, will include another reset. Instead, Season 2.5 updates will most likely focus on balance modifications and tweaks to competitive systems like tournament rooms and custom matchmaking lobbies.

The choice to forgo mid-season resets is consistent with NetEase’s response to player feedback, which emphasized consistency and rewarded continued effort. To validate Season 2.5 details, players can consult official Marvel Rivals channels or patch notes, as mid-season upgrades often prioritize content and balance over rank revisions.
